Unlike standard pumps, which are primarily used for water or clean liquids, slurry pumps are constructed with robust materials that can withstand continuous contact with solids. The impeller of a slurry pump is specially designed to create a turbulent flow, ensuring efficient solids handling and preventing clogging.
Horizontal slurry pumps play a crucial role in various industries, including mining, mineral processing, dredging, and wastewater treatment. In the mining industry, for example, slurry pumps are used to transport ore, tailings, and other mining by-products. These pumps are also commonly used in dredging operations to move sediment and gravel from water bodies

Horizontal slurry pumps are known for their rugged construction and durability. They are designed to withstand the harsh conditions often encountered in industries where slurries are present. The pump casings are typically made of high-quality materials such as cast iron, stainless steel, or various alloys, ensuring long-lasting performance even in corrosive environments.
Efficiency is a key consideration in slurry pump design. The impeller, which is the rotating component responsible for creating the centrifugal force, is carefully engineered to handle the specific characteristics of the slurry. The impeller blades are designed to generate a turbulent flow, effectively moving the solids along with the liquid. This design prevents clogging and ensures optimal performance.
